If you replaced a SIP with another SIP with a different SPA installed, the system recognizes the
interfaces on the previously configured SPA but does not recognize the new SPA interfaces. The new
interfaces remain in the shutdown state until you configure them.

Using the ping Command to Verify Network Connectivity

This section provides brief descriptions of the ping command. The ping command allows you to verify
that a SPA port is functioning properly and to check the path between a specific port and connected
devices at various locations on the network. After you verify that the system and the SIP have booted
successfully and are operational, you can use this command to verify the status of the SPA ports. Refer

The ping command sends an echo request out to a remote device at an IP address that you specify. After
sending a series of signals, the command waits a specified time for the remote device to echo the signals.
Each returned signal is displayed as an exclamation point (!) on the console terminal; each signal that is
not returned before the specified timeout is displayed as a period (.). A series of exclamation points
(!!!!!) indicates a good connection; a series of periods (.....) or the messages [timed out] or [failed]
indicate that the connection failed.
